众力资讯网

同学们起立!第二部分:区块链的底层架构与工作机制

大家好,我是程序猿Tom,一位头发还没有掉光的程序员。在上一章节《区块链的起源与设计哲学》中,我们探讨了区块链技术的诞生

大家好,我是程序猿Tom,一位头发还没有掉光的程序员。在上一章节《区块链的起源与设计哲学》中,我们探讨了区块链技术的诞生背景,以及中本聪(Satoshi Nakamoto)如何通过数字签名链和工作量证明(Proof-of-Work, PoW)系统解决“双重支付”问题,引领了一场去中心化的革命。在本篇《区块链的底层架构与工作机制》中,我将以学者的身份,深入剖析“链”的概念,带您领略区块链技术的核心奥秘。

区块链的核心在于其巧妙结合了三种核心技术:数据结构(链式区块)、密码学、以及分布式节点共识 ②。这些要素共同构建了一个透明、安全、

可篡改的数据记录系统。

01区块链的“积木”:数据结构与哈希链

区块链顾名思义,由“区块”(Block)连接成“链”(Chain)。

1.1 交易与区块的形成

在区块链中,交易是状态转移的基本单位,利用非对称加密技术,通过数字签名来验证支付的有效性和发起者的身份 ①。多个交易会被批量打包进一个区块。每个区块都包含以下关键信息:批量交易记录、时间戳、以及一个对前一区块的哈希引用。正是这个哈希引用,将当前区块与前一个区块在数学上链接起来,形成了不可逆转的链式结构 ①。

图一 区块链

区块链在比特币的设计中,区块中的第一笔交易是一个特殊的交易,即新货币的创建,这是对成功创建区块的节点的激励 ①。这一设计机制将记账权和激励直接绑定。

1.2 存储效率的考虑

对于计算机专业的学生而言,理解设计者在效率上的考量至关重要。白皮书指出,一旦某个货币的蕞新交易已经被足够多的后续区块覆盖,那么早期的支付交易就可以被丢弃,以节省磁盘空间 ①。这表明,区块链的设计在保证安全性的同时,也对历史数据的存储效率进行了优化。

02安全之锚:密码学基础在区块链中的应用

区块链技术的安全性主要依赖于强大的密码学算法 ②。

2.1 哈希函数

哈希函数(Hash Function)是区块链完整性保障的基石。它能将任意长度的输入数据转化成固定长度的输出值(即数字指纹)。任何对区块数据的微小改动都会导致其哈希值发生巨大变化。这不仅用于将区块连接起来(前一区块的哈希值包含在当前区块中),也是工作量证明的基础 ②。

图二 哈希函数

2.2 非对称加密

非对称加密(Asymmetric Encryption)技术是数字身份和授权的基础。用户通过公钥和私钥对来进行身份识别。私钥用于生成数字签名,授权交易;公钥则对外公开,用于验证该签名是否确实由私钥持有者发出。这种机制保护了交易的隐私,并提供了防篡改、可验证的交易记录 ②。

03核心驱动力:分布式共识机制详解

共识机制是区块链去中心化运作的核心。它是一种“加密共识机制”,用于确保所有分布式节点对系统状态达成一致,保证了网络的安全性和可靠性,而无需依赖中央权威 ②。

3.1 工作量证明(PoW)

工作量证明(PoW)是比特币最早采用的共识算法。节点(矿工)通过竞争计算,寻找一个满足难度要求(例如,哈希值前缀包含特定数量的零)的工作量证明 ①。一旦找到,该节点即可广播其区块,并获得新创建的货币作为奖励 ①。

从技术角度看,PoW的安全性依赖于严格的数学基础。白皮书引用了费勒(W. Feller)的概率论应用来分析攻击者(拥有部分算力的恶意节点)成功的概率 P 。例如,当恶意节点的算力占比达到 q=0.20 时,如果该交易被 z=11 个区块覆盖,其成功进行攻击(即篡改历史记录)的概率 P 将小于 0.001 。这证明了PoW机制通过计算成本,有效地将历史记录的真实性与严谨的概率模型绑定,实现了去中心化的时间戳。

图三 工作量证明(Pow)

3.2 权益证明(PoS)及其替代方案

由于PoW机制需要消耗巨大的计算资源和能源,权益证明(PoS)被开发出来作为主要的替代方案。PoS通过要求验证者质押加密货币(即“权益”)来竞争记账权 ②。这是一种通过经济激励建立去中心化共识的方式,解决了PoW的高能耗问题 ②。无论采用PoW还是PoS,区块链的核心都在于使用加密证明,而不是依赖可信的第三方来达成去中心化共识 ②。

图四 权益证明(PoS)

重要表格 1: 区块链核心共识机制对比

04

区块链的分类:公有链、私有链与联盟链的权衡

区块链根据其访问权限和中心化程度可以分为不同的类型 ③:

公有链(Public Blockchain): 任何人都可以自由加入、读取数据和提交交易。它需要激励机制(如挖矿奖励)来吸引参与者提供算力或质押加密货币。公有链的去中心化程度较高,旨在解决双重支付问题 ③。

私有链(Private Blockchain): 由特定的实体或链的所有者完全控制。参与者需要经过许可才能加入,去中心化程度极低,但具有高效率和高安全性,常用于单一企业内部 ③。

联盟链(Consortium Blockchain): 介于公有链和私有链之间,由多个预选组织共同管理。

重要表格 2: 区块链类型对比

在实际的商业落地中,许多企业应用会选择私有链或联盟链,这种技术选择牺牲了比特币蕞初追求的去中心化,以换取更高的交易效率和合规性控制。这体现了技术理想与现实商业需求之间的务实取舍。

引用的著作

比特币:一种点对点电子货币系统 - Bitcoin.org, 访问时间为 十一月 25, 2025, https://bitcoin.org/files/bitcoin-paper/bitcoin_zh_cn.pdf

区块链原理的工作原理是什么 - 亚马逊云科技, 访问时间为 十一月 25, 2025, https://www.amazonaws.cn/what-is/blockchain-principles/

區塊鏈- 維基百科,自由的百科全書, 访问时间为 十一月 25, 2025, https://zh.wikipedia.org/zh-tw/%E5%8C%BA%E5%9D%97%E9%93%BE

文章编辑:wx144380

免责声明:小编只做软件开/发和商业模式设计,不参与实际的商业模式运营或投资活动。玩项目的玩家勿扰!玩家勿扰!完家勿扰!

本文部分资料来自网上搜索,如有侵权请联系删除!

想要了解更多互联网资/讯。研发Dapp,小程序,app,分销模式,商城系统软/件,关注小编。